    Moss: The Forgotten Relic Brings VR Magic Beyond Headsets

    If you have ever paid attention to the VR gaming space, chances are high you have heard of Moss and Moss: Book II. These beloved titles set the standard for immersive storytelling, introducing players to one of the most charming protagonists in modern gaming. What if Polyarc and Blackbird Interactive dropped a massive update for flat-screen gamers?

    No VR headset? No problem. Moss: The Forgotten Relic has officially landed, translating the entire VR classic into a complete, non-VR PC adventure.

    Ditching the Headset for standard displays

    Released on July 16, 2026, Moss: The Forgotten Relic takes the original virtual reality experience and reshapes it from the ground up for PC and traditional screens. This release bundles Moss, Moss: Book II, and the fan-favorite Twilight Garden DLC into one massive, continuous journey.

    Rather than a lazy port, the development team rebuilt the presentation from scratch. The game debuts a smart follow-camera system designed to keep the action smooth, alongside enhanced visuals, performance optimizations, and fresh handcrafted cutscenes designed specifically for standard monitors. You step into a mythic, fallen kingdom being reclaimed by untamed nature. At the heart of the journey is Quill, a tiny mouse with an enormous spirit.

    What makes the adventure special is your role: you are not just controlling Quill from afar—you are an actual spiritual entity within her world. Quill looks directly at you, high-fives you after tough encounters, and turns to you when puzzles require a helping hand.

    Gameplay blends clever environmental puzzles, action-platforming, and fluid combat. Every level feels like a living, moving diorama where you manipulate elements of the world while guiding Quill through hazardous ruins and arcane threats.

    Whether you missed out on the original release due to hardware barriers or simply want to re-experience Quill’s story on your setup, this package offers the definitive way to jump in.
